Ceramic case for this dark side of the moon. That's the risk of such a material, very scratch resistant and light but more brittle. I would be shocked only if that was a stainless steel speed master.

Confirm not covered by warranty as it is user damage from drop or knock. Far as I know no ceramic case watch from any manufacturer is touted to be shatter proof...
